Burlesque extravaganza heads back to Horsham

Flushed with success and now entering its fourth fabulous year, the world’s original touring burlesque event is about to hit town.
An Evening of BurlesqueAn Evening of Burlesque
An Evening of Burlesque

Officially Britain’s biggest burlesque extravaganza – a quarter of a million people have now seen this show – An Evening of Burlesque is responsible for exposing the cream of the West End of London’s thriving burlesque scene to the world.

The show heads back to The Capitol, Horsham, this year on Friday, October 3 (8pm).

Not only has the ever-so-cheeky production revealed the secrets of the art of burlesque to delighted audiences across the UK, it has also thrilled theatregoers at the swishest venues throughout Europe as well.

From Milan to Zurich, St Petersburg to Minsk, Leipzig to Verona, Dresden to Riga, Padova to Dessau the reaction has been the same – absolutely incredible, says show producer Michael Taylor.

“Nothing is lost in translation,” says Michael. “An Evening of Burlesque’s content – sparkling glamour, physical humour and a dynamic score – are appreciated in any language.”

An Evening of Burlesque features corsets, killer heels and stockings aplenty – and that’s just the theatregoers who come to see the show...

Michael explains: “For a spectacle that sparkles from its elaborately-decorated headdresses to its immaculately varnished toes, it might not come as a complete surprise that audiences are predominantly female.

“Also, we’re pleased to report that, with a prize for the best-dressed member of the audience, theatregoers revel in dressing up for the occasion.”

For over-18s only, the show’s success is built on a combination of sultry vocals, breathtaking choreography, mischief, magic, frivolity and fun.

“It’s all tease, no sleaze,” says Michael. “The show combines musical and theatrical parody, cutting-edge variety, magic, comedy and dance with the art of striptease.”

An Evening of Burlesque can star the following burlesque all-star performers:

l Amber Topaz – the Yorkshire Tease, the leading lady. Her powerful vocals and an uncompromising stage persona are the epitome of burlesque.

l The Folly Mixtures – a burlesque quartet choreographed to thrill, featuring a tasty assortment of lip-smacking themed routines that have thrilled fans throughout the UK and Europe.

l Tempest Rose – compere, singer and a true star of the international burlesque scene, Tempest is a regular face on national TV and has performed from Las Vegas to Rome and all points in between.

l Miss Ooh La Lou – described as Police Academy dream babe, a bit Britney, a bit Goldie Hawn. Trained at Italia Conti, she has appeared in numerous West End musicals.

l Miss Felixy Splits – another product of Italia Conti, the all-singing, all-dancing performer is the ultimate cheesecake pin-up.

l Bettsie Bon Bon – described as akin to the star of an MGM movie classic, trained in street dance, she’s sauce, tease and glamour personified.

l Liberty Sweet – sensuous and graceful, a nimble vamp, trained at the Royal Academy of Dance, comes with her own sparkle-encrusted swing. A star of the Edinburgh Festival and ITV’s Alan Titchmarsh Show!
